When Queanbeyan locals arrange a termite extermination, they usually question what occurs when the specialist shows up and how the procedure will impact daily life in the house. Understanding the sequence of actions and the safety measures required for contemporary treatments can relieve concerns for households with children, family pets, or anyone who is specifically conscious chemicals.

Most treatments start with a verification call or message ahead of the arranged consultation, outlining what requires to be ready in advance. This usually includes clearing gain access to around the boundary of the home, moving garden furniture, pot plants or saved products far from external walls, and ensuring family pets are protected somewhere they can not interfere with equipment or wander into treated locations while work is underway.

When the technician gets here, they typically visit the home once more before beginning any hands‑on work, verifying that the treatment strategy matches what was noted during the preliminary inspection. This last confirmation is important since situations may have shifted in between the inspection and the service date especially if recent rain, landscaping, or construction has actually modified gain access to paths around the foundation or subfloor.

For a standard liquid soil treatment, the technician will trench and deal with the soil around the border of the building, sometimes drilling through concrete courses, driveways or paved locations where access is otherwise blocked. The termiticide utilized in the majority of residential treatments today is developed to bind firmly to soil particles, which considerably decreases the possibility of it seeping into garden beds, veggie spots or nearby waterways once it has actually been properly used.

Households with yard vegetable gardens or fruit trees close to the home often fret about chemical treatments affecting their produce. Trusted suppliers will generally advise on safe ranges and timing around edible plants, and in a lot of cases recommend a baiting system instead of a soil treatment where gardens sit especially close to the structure. This versatility allows treatment plans to be adjusted around a household's particular lifestyle rather than using the exact same method to every residential or commercial property no matter how it is utilized.

Animals, particularly dogs that like to dig or remain in the garden, are a frequent concern. Most pest‑control specialists will recommend keeping animals away from freshly dealt with soil for a quick duration right after the application; when the product has actually bonded to the earth, the location is normally safe for regular activity. The exact waiting times depend on the specific formula used, so it's best to ask the specialist for the proper assistance rather than presuming a one‑size‑fits‑all guideline.

Indoor elements of a termite control job like tiring into baseboard trim or applying treatment to lumber in roof cavities normally produce little odor and dry quick, so most homes can resume regular use of the dealt with rooms quickly later. The service technicians will typically mention any spots that need additional airing and recommend when it is safe for children or family pets to re‑enter the cured area without limitations.

As soon as the treatment has been finished, the majority of service providers issue a composed report describing precisely what was done, which products were utilized and what warranty conditions use going forward. Keeping this paperwork somewhere accessible works not only for future referral however likewise if the property is ever offered, because buyers and their pest inspectors will typically request proof of previous treatment work throughout the conveyancing procedure.

Continuous observation after the first treatment is as essential as the day of application itself. Bait stations need to be checked and refilled frequently, and areas where the soil has been treated ought to be reviewed to make sure the protective barrier is still effective especially after significant landscaping modifications or heavy rain that may disrupt the treated soil. Preparation these follow‑up consultations ahead of time, rather than waiting for a concern to surface, usually yields far better long‑term results.
